Public Auction on Red Willow Lake Farm March 30 1901

J C Ressler proprietor sells at public auction on his Sec 1 148 61 farm half mile west of Red Willow Lake seven miles north of Binford. Items include horses, dry mares, hay, two wagons, mower, harrows, plows, harness, hay racks and tools. Terms: up to 10 dollars cash. balances to Oct 1 1901 or Oct 1 1902 on notes with 8 percent interest. Ree lunch served day of sale.
